Understanding the Functionality of Hollow Screw Jacks
At its core, the Hollow Screw Jack is a mechanical device designed to convert rotational motion into linear motion. It consists of a screw, which is housed within a cylindrical casing. When the screw is turned, it moves in an upward or downward motion, depending on the direction of rotation. This unique design allows for both lifting and holding loads at specific heights, making it an indispensable tool in various applications.
One of the most significant advantages of a hollow screw jack is its ability to provide substantial lifting force in a compact design. This feature is particularly beneficial in tight spaces where traditional lifting systems would be impractical. Additionally, the hollow screw design allows for better torque transmission and enhances stability during operation.
Key Components of a Hollow Screw Jack
To fully appreciate the effectiveness of a hollow screw jack, it’s essential to understand its main components. The primary parts include the screw, nut, housing, and lifting block. Each component plays a specific role in the overall functionality of the device.
- Screw: The screw is the heart of the hollow screw jack. Its threads engage with the nut to convert rotational movement into lifting action.
- Nut: The nut is fixed to the housing and remains stationary while the screw rotates. As the screw turns, it moves the lifting block vertically.
- Housing: The housing encases the screw and nut, providing a robust structure that supports the load and protects the internal components.
- Lifting Block: The lifting block is attached to the screw and raises or lowers the load as the screw rotates.
These components work seamlessly together, ensuring that the hollow screw jack operates effortlessly and efficiently.
Applications of Hollow Screw Jacks
The versatility of the Hollow Screw Jack is evident in its wide range of applications. Here are a few industries that benefit significantly from its use:
Construction: In construction, hollow screw jacks are commonly employed for lifting heavy materials during various phases of building. They provide a reliable and easy method for adjusting the height of support beams or formwork.
Manufacturing: The manufacturing sector uses hollow screw jacks for precise positioning of machinery and components on assembly lines. This ensures accuracy as well as safety during the manufacturing process.
Automotive: In the automotive industry, these devices are crucial for raising vehicles for maintenance and repairs. Their compact design allows mechanics to access hard-to-reach areas without compromising safety.
Logistics and Warehousing: Hollow screw jacks are also prevalent in logistics, where they assist in lifting and positioning pallets and goods within storage facilities.
